I got this on mine when I set it up. Just use the full paths so...

/usr/bin/php -q /where/ever/file/is/mohstats.php
/home/cod/.callofduty/main/games_mp.log

Then it will run no matter which user is doing it and from where. The
path to php may be different (the above is for gentoo), if you have
shell access type

whereis php

and you should get the path.

I have a problem, when i try to execute the following command
php -q mohstats.php /home/cod/.callofduty/main/games_mp.log

This is what i get for answer
-bash: php: command not found

 PHP works, because our forum works fine

Has somebody the solution for me?!?
